ZIP Code 29853
ZIP Code Tabulation Area in Barnwell County, South Carolina.

Covering part of Barnwell County, South Carolina, ZIP Code 29853 has about 6,011 residents. At $39,003, its median household income sits below Barnwell County's $41,800.
From 2019 to 2023, ZIP Code 29853's population declined 2.1% from 6,139 to 6,011, while its median gross rent rose 12.8% from $608 to $686.
53.2% of homes are single-family detached houses. The typical home was built around 1992.
